Big Noise Go Boom: Bass Management and Your Subwoofer

May 13, 2014 by Samuel Ejnes

  Let’s talk about surround sound systems for a quick second, shall we? A modern surround sound system, in its simplest form, consists of six channels; Left, Center, Right, Left Surround, Right Surround, and the Low Frequency Effect channel.
